1.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Commission is...

...pay based on a percentage of sales made.

...pay based on a fixed number of hours worked.

...pay based on a fixed yearly amount.

...pay based on the number of items produced.

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Amir is paid 9.50 Euros per hour for a standard 36 hour week. He is paid 'time-and-a-half' for all overtime worked. Calculate his gross income for a week when we works 40 hours.

399 Euros

380 Euros

570 Euros

20748 Euros

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Sarah's salary is 45,000 Euros per year. The following income tax is payable on her salary: 4783.25 Euros plus 28% of any salary over 34,000. Work out her total income tax.

9520 Euros

126,000 Euros

7863.25 Euros

37,136.75 Euros

5.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Krista invests $1400 in a bank account with 1.2% per annum simple interest. How much will she have in her account after 4 years?

$1467.20

$67.20

$16.80

$1332.80

Tags

CCSS.7.RP.A.3

6.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

If you invest an amount at 6% simple interest per annum. How long will it take your original amount to double

17 years

16 years

6 years

12 years

Tags

CCSS.7.RP.A.3

7.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

A sofa is advertised for 600 Euros cash or 24 monthly payments of 32 Euros per month. What is the difference between the hire-purchase price and the cash price?

568 Euros

768 Euros

No difference

168 Euros
